About ALMR
Alamar Biosciences, Inc. is a commercial-stage proteomics company engaged in protein detection and analysis. The Company's proprietary NULISA (Nucleic Acid Linked Immuno-Sandwich Assay) technology addresses the limitations of existing proteomics tools by detecting protein biomarkers at extremely low concentrations in non-invasive biological fluids, such as blood, with ultra-high sensitivity, high specificity, flexible multiplexing, dynamic range and automation. Its integrated platform consists of proprietary instruments, consumables and analytical software that is designed to provide scientists with an end-to-end solution to precisely and consistently measure from one to hundreds of low-abundances and difficult-to-detect biomarkers across the continuum of discovery, translational research and ultimately diagnostics. Its instrument, the ARGO HT System, is designed to automate high-sensitivity and high-plex proteomics analysis and is available for research use only applications.

- Innovative Immunoassay: Alamar Biosciences has launched the first commercial eMTBR-Tau immunoassay, now available in the NULISAseq™ Neuro 220 multiplex panel, which can be immediately deployed on the ARGO™ HT instruments, thereby enhancing early detection capabilities for Alzheimer's disease.
- Significance of Biomarker: eMTBR-Tau serves as a plasma biomarker that specifically reflects tau tangle pathology and has strong associations with cognitive decline, clinical disease staging, and therapeutic response monitoring, which is expected to drive advancements in precision medicine.
- Clinical Research Potential: The assay's high sensitivity and specificity provide significant value in clinical research and trials, allowing for direct measurement of biological responses to tau-targeted therapies, addressing the critical need for blood-based biomarkers of treatment efficacy.
- Conference Presentation: Alamar will showcase eMTBR-Tau data at the 2026 Alzheimer’s Association International Conference in London, where researchers will present the assay's analytical performance and its correlation with tau PET imaging, further advancing Alzheimer's research.

- Financial Performance: Alamar Biosciences reported a Q1 GAAP EPS of -$1.74, yet achieved revenues of $26 million, reflecting a robust 98.5% year-over-year growth that underscores the company's strong market potential.
- IPO Dynamics: The firm is experiencing increased cash burn leading up to its IPO, indicating a significant investment in expansion and R&D, which may exert short-term pressure on its financial health.
- Stock Price Movement: Following its IPO, Alamar Biosciences' stock surged by 40%, signaling positive market sentiment regarding its business model and future growth prospects, potentially attracting more investor interest.
- Pricing Strategy: The company successfully priced its upsized IPO at $17 per share, demonstrating market confidence in its valuation while providing necessary capital for future development.
